Python語言簡體的複習 1

2021-10-23 04:41:14 字數 2745 閱讀 8337

****1.注釋

每個語言都有屬於自己的注釋,注釋的主要作用呢,就是為了給開發人員自己**,同時在專案開發的時候,注釋是可以起到非常重要的作用,在每個功能塊下寫下功能相應的注釋,不僅僅可以增加美觀,甚至對開發人員協同開發起到重要的作用

python的注釋一般分為兩種,一種單行注釋,一行是多行注釋

1.單行注釋就是簡單的:#

2.多行注釋就是:''

''具體的使用可以根據自己的需求而定

**2.變數以及型別

**每個語言都需要乙個變數來儲存資料,可以是數字也可以是字串,變數就好比乙個籃子一樣,資料儲存在籃子之中

型別:這個是乙個至關重要的關鍵字,資料需要不同型別的切換,最常見的型別有:字串,數字,布林型別,列表(list),元祖(tuple),字典(dict)

可以使用type(變數的名字),來檢視變數的型別

3.識別符號,符號

好了,最簡單識別符號,以及符號之間的使用我覺得是不必很在意的複習的了,識別符號最主要注意的點主要是存在於:命名方面上的格式,而命名方面主要是我們開發者自己來命名,這裡特別注意的一點是,python變數的命名不可以使用數字或者下劃線來進行首次開頭的命名!

其次還有關鍵字,python中有部分的英語單詞是重要的關鍵字,該關鍵字裡面已經是被python語言給承擔了,裡面有相對應的封裝方法,所以我們開發者在命名變數名的時候不可以使用關鍵字。

4.判斷語句

if else語句的判斷,其實是非常的容易,想想當現實生活中,你需要去買一瓶牛奶,你就需要帶著足夠的錢才能夠購買,不然你無法購買牛奶,之後你就得回家拿錢才可以去買,使用**來寫最簡單的就是

if 要判斷的條件:

條件成立時,要做的事情

#打個比喻,加入你手中的money只有三塊錢

money =

3miku =

4#如果你手中的錢比牛奶的錢多,那麼自然而然就能買到啦!

if money <= miku:

print

('買到了牛奶了哈哈哈~'

)#否則你就回家拿錢吧!

else

:print

('錢不夠,回家拿錢')

以上通過**把現實這個很簡單的問題寫了出來了,判斷的語句就是這樣和現實乙個道理,最主要是要學會隨機應變。

5.elif以及if的巢狀

if和else是乙個最為基本的乙個判斷語句,簡單的來說就是如果條件成立了,則執行什麼,否則:執行什麼,這就是if判斷中最為基礎的一種,可以除此之外還有乙個elif的判斷使用的。

其實elif也很好的理解,當if這個條件一成立的時候,elif也可以跟隨著if條件成立的前提下判斷條件二elif是否成立,如果成立則執行…否則…這裡的elif與if的使用非常的相似。

score =

77if score>=

90and score<=

100:

print

('本次考試,等級為a'

)elif score>=

80and score<90:

print

('本次考試,等級為b'

)elif score>=

70and score<80:

print

('本次考試,等級為c'

)elif score>=

60and score<70:

print

('本次考試,等級為d'

)elif score>=

0and score<60:

print

('本次考試,等級為e'

)if 條件一成立:

執行語句...

elif 條件二成立:

執行語句...

elif 條件二成立:

執行語句...

elif 條件二成立:

執行語句...

else

: 執行語句.

..

然後值得一提的是,elif必須是要跟在if判斷後面使用,否則會語句使用有問題報錯的。

其次就是if巢狀了,if巢狀是在第一條件成立下的同時再次巢狀乙個if判斷,可是如果if判斷第一條件也無法成立,那麼巢狀在裡面的if判斷自然而然的是沒有任何的作用的,以下用**寫出最簡單的乙個例項:

ticket =

1# 用1代表有車票,0代表沒有車票

knife_lengh =

9# 刀子的長度,單位為cm

if ticket ==1:

print

("有車票,可以進站"

)if knife_lengh <10:

print

("通過安檢"

)print

("終於可以見到ta了,美滋滋~~~"

)else

:print

("沒有通過安檢"

)print

("刀子的長度超過規定,等待警察處理..."

)else

:print

("沒有車票,不能進站"

)print

("親愛的,那就下次見了"

)

哈哈哈,這裡是乙個很有意思的乙個例項,可是也非常清楚的知道if巢狀的乙個使用機制,當條件成立的時候,if巢狀才可以使用。

該文章為本人複習專用,可能之前有些欠缺或者不對的地方,如果有看到的可以指正一下,該文章還會繼續更新下去~

C語言複習 1

程式是人機互動的媒介,有輸出必然也有輸入。在c語言中,有多個函式可以從鍵盤獲得使用者輸入 scanf 和 printf 類似,scanf 可以輸入多種型別的資料。getchar getche getch 這三個函式都用於輸入單個字元。gets 獲取一行資料,並作為字串處理。scanf 是最靈活 最複...

C語言複習(1)

1.邏輯運算子的短路效應 邏輯運算子的短路效應 對於邏輯與 來說,同為真時才為真,所以當條件1為假時不需要計算條件2 對於邏輯或 來說,同為假時才為假,所以當條件1為真時不需要計算條件2 下面的運算形式為,先計算 a b 的結果,a為真,故再計算 b,結果也為真,所以表示式 a b 為真 對於 a ...

C CLI複習總結 1 語言

只說重點難點,以及在iso c 上的變化 1.運算子過載 要加static了 2.建構函式間的呼叫 呼叫同class 中的其他建構函式,用 gcnew this c 的形式 呼叫父類的建構函式,如c2 c1 1 呼叫了c1 int a 這個建構函式 3.取代 作為取引用,當然還有 取控制代碼 4.覆...